Is there a way to directly stream data (audio/video) from frontend to the storj node. At present, as per my understanding, the flow is like this Frontend → Backend → Storj. I have to first stream data from frontend to backend and using the libuplink library, then store it on storj.
Storj DCS is not really for streaming live content. If it is a live event then https://videocoin.network/ might be more suitable.
You can integrate StorJ DCS with a Videocoin workflow, if you save the stream and wish to allow subsequent re-streams - Integrating Storj into your VideoCoin Network Workflows | by VideoCoin | VideoCoin | Medium